Author: DorisPetty87 Surnames: Hatcher - Watkins - Rafferty - Walker - Kessinger - Campbell - Floyd - Fitzgerald - Robinette - Denson - Lewis - Wyatt - Miller - Classification: obituary Message Board URL: http://boards.rootsweb.com/surnames.hatcher/1920/mb.ashx Message Board Post: Roanoke, VA Houston Jennings Hatcher Jr. 1933-2008 Houston Jennings (Hootie) Hatcher Jr., 75, of Natural Bridge, died Sunday, August 31, 2008. He was born July 22, 1933, in Rockbridge County, a son of the late Houston Jennings Hatcher Sr. and Carrie Lillian Watkins. In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by one brother, Daniel Lee Hatcher; and two sisters, June Hatcher Rafferty and Carrie Hatcher Walker. Hootie was employed by John Carter Lumber, Bedford, Virginia. He was a member of the Lexington Moose Lodge and Past Governor of the Glasgow Lodge. Hootie was also the owner and founder of Hootieville Bluegrass Music Festivals. He is survived by his wife, Mildred Kessinger Hatcher, of Natural Bridge; one stepson, Wilbur P. "Billy" Kessinger, of Fairfax; and twelve children from a previous marriage, Tommy and Sandy Hatcher, of Lexington, James Hatcher, of Natural Bridge, Leah Hatcher Campbell and Steve, of Natural Bridge, Robert Hatcher and Pam, of Watertown, New York, Johnny Hatcher, of New London, Va., William ! and Dorthea, of Natural Bridge, Mike Hatcher, of Rustburg, Helen Hatcher Floyd and Steve, of Rockbridge Baths, Mary Hatcher Fitzgerald and Kenny, of Bedford, David Hatcher, of Natural Bridge, Heidi Hatcher Robinette, of North Carolina, and Douglas Hatcher and Daye, of Natural Bridge; 20 grandchildren; nine greatgrandchildren; two God grandchildren, Abigail Lauren Floyd and Jacob Allen Floyd, both of Buena Vista; two brothers, Henry M. Hatcher and Gilmore W. Hatcher; four sisters, Susie J. Denson, of Roanoke, Ruth J. Lewis, of Port Royal, S.C., Margaret Wyatt, of Natural Bridge, and Stephanie J. Miller, of Roanoke; and a very special grandson, Stephen Floyd Jr., of Rockbridge Baths. Funeral service will be conducted at Harrison Funeral Chapel on Thursday, September 4, 2008, at 2 p.m. with the Rev. Tony Nix officiating. Interment will follow at Broad Creek Cemetery. Visitation will be held on Wednesday, September 3, 2008, from 6 to 8 p.m. at Harrison Funeral Home & Crematory,! Lexington, Va. Author: kaitysmom Surnames: McMillan, Connell, Shemwell, Bateman, Hatcher, Smith, Frazee, Allison Classification: obituary Message Board URL: http://boards.rootsweb.com/surnames.hatcher/1919/mb.ashx Message Board Post: Source: "The Stewart-Houston Times" Newspaper, a weekly newspaper of Stewart County and Houston County in Tennessee Date of Newspaper: Tuesday, May 9, 1972 Page: A-2 Name: John Paul McMillan Age: Not Listed Born: June 10, 1891 in Houston County, TN. Died: April 27, 1972 at Trinity Hospital in Houston County, TN. Funeral: April 30, 1972 with Nave Funeral Home in Houston County, TN. Burial: McMillan Cemetery in Houston County, TN. Parents: James L. McMillan and Mary Alice Connell Deceased 1st Spouse: Mrs. Florence (Shemwell) McMillan Surviving 2nd Spouse: Mrs. Clara (Bateman) (Hatcher) McMillan Surviving Children: James McMillan, Charles McMillan Surviving Step-Children: Irving Hatcher, Robert Hatcher, Mrs. Anna Lee Smith, Mrs. Margaret Nell Frazee Surviving Siblings: Mrs. Lois Allison, Charles Merton McMillan, Maurice McMillan If anyone is interested in a copy of the full and original obituary, I would be glad to share. Author: DorisPetty87 Surnames: Hatcher - Stockton - Dunlap - Classification: obituary Message Board URL: http://boards.rootsweb.com/surnames.hatcher/1918/mb.ashx Message Board Post: Thomas Richard Hatcher August 19, 2008 - 8:44PM THE PORTERVILLE RECORDER Thomas Richard Hatcher "BUD", a resident of Porterville, passed away here on Saturday, August 16, 2008. He was born in Slabfork, West Virginia on January 20, 1936. He was 72. Visitation will be held at Myers Chapel on Wednesday, August 20th from 2:00 p.m. to 7:00 p.m. A graveside service will be held at Hillcrest Memorial Park on Thursday, August 21st at 10:00 a.m. He attended Alta Vista (K-8th) and was a Porterville High School graduate, class of 1954. He was employed at Hildebrand Bakery for 2 years, Merritt's Packing for 1 year, Linders for 14 years, Billious for 13 years, Trimmer of Fresno for 2 years and Morris Levin & Son for 13 years. His hobbies included outdoor activities such as hunting, fishing, gold mining, rock collector, created jewelry, lapidary, and home improvements of his house. He was a John Wayne fan and enjoyed military movies. He had memberships with Handyman Club of America, North American Hunting and National Rifleman Association. He was a member of Masons, Shriners, The Tehran Temple and Scottish Rites. He achieved his 32nd degree with the Masons. He was highly skilled and certificated in various brand names of small engines, chains saws, and hardware products for home/business. He served in the National Guard of California as a Sergeant E5. He is survived by his wife Charlene Hatcher of Porterville, they would have celebrated their 50th wedding anniversary on September 20th; daughter Deborah and her husband Jeffrey Stockton of Porterville; son Rick Hatcher and his companion Laurel Lakin of Porterville; brother Howard Hatcher and his wife Delores of Bakersfield; sister June and her husband Ira Dunlap of Porterville; six grandchildren, Shawnee, Justin and Alexis Hatcher and Thomas, Robert and Joseph Stockton; and 1 great-grandchild, Shayne Hatcher. He was preceded in death by his parents Curtis and Sadie Hatcher and his brother James (Big Jim) Hatcher.
